Obverse description Frontal enthroned figure of Albrecht I depicted in regal vestments, holding a sceptre in the right hand and an orb in the left, surmounted by a crown. The ruler is shown in a stylized, hieratic manner characteristic of late medieval German hammered coinage. Flanking the central figure are smaller attendant figures or heraldic elements. A beaded inner circle frames the composition, with a partial Latin legend running along the outer periphery.

Reverse description Architectural depiction of Aachen Cathedral rendered in a detailed, schematic style, showing the octagonal Carolingian Palatine Chapel with its distinctive domed roof and flanking towers surmounted by globes or finials. A cross appears prominently above the structure. The building's façade features arched windows and decorative elements, all enclosed within a beaded inner circle. A partial Latin legend surrounds the composition along the coin's outer edge.
